As of Windows 7, some versions of Samba require some modifications to the Local Security policy to allow Windows to connect.

Symptoms of this problem are that windows cannot connect and simply keeps asking for username and password.

To make this change:

Go to: Control Panel -> Administrative Tools -> Local Security Policy

Select: Local Policies -> Security Options

Set the following values:

Network Security: LAN Manager Authentication level

Send LM & NTLM responses

Network Security: Minimum session security for NTLM SSP"

Uncheck Require 128-bit encryption
